The Game. Kountermove fantasy MMA works similar to today’s football, baseball, and basketball fantasy sports leagues. We currently feature single event, salary cap style games and have a number of new game formats coming soon. Kountermove offers members the opportunity to play against each other for the chance to win a designated prize pool of real money.
Members select games based on entry fee amounts, number of opponents, and whether they’d like to draft from the main or full card of fighters. Our member’s teams of fighters are then matched up against each other during real MMA events to compete for the cash prize pool.
Winners and losers are determined by points based on each fighter’s statistical output – strikes landed, submission attempts, knockdowns, dominant positions, rounds won, and knockout or submission bonuses. All entry fees are added into a prize pool that is divided among the league’s winners at the end of the game.
